Re: Rob Heyen- new K for Sale???
I believe (but am not certain) that Tim Kelly's K was a 1907. This one appears to be a 1906. A couple inches shorter wheelbase, and "tulip" (European) style body. Tim Kelly's had the '07/'08 style body, which had straighter lines than the one shown above.

Re: Rob Heyen- new K for Sale???
Yes, it's the 1906 Kim, Dean Yoder and I callaborated on. Dean got it up and running, and he and Kim took it through the New London to New Brighton tour and Old Car Festival. The motor and drive train are in great shape with an older reproduction body. Bruce Van Sloun restored the original 1906 Holley Magneto, making this the only running 06 with an original Holley magneto.
Our goal is to find the right caretaker who will keep it on the road. Below is a link showing Kim driving with Dean riding at last years OCF, with the other three Model K st the pass in review:

A photo if the only working Ford Six 1906 Holley mag. The worlds first working production automobile CDI:
The 06 version had a separate coil box for six coils. This box contains the mag coil and condensor.
